Hopefully, she waited for the phone to ring, a car in the drive, a sound of his arriving He said he would be there tonight, so to be ready to go out to eat dinner Hurrying home from work, she rushed, getting all dressed up to go out with the man of her life, her Love Not seeing him for a few days because of the holidays with his wife and family, she waited anxiously Suddenly the phone rang, hurriedly picking it up she heard his voice, "Honey, something's come up with the family" He asked her if she could go ahead and eat, maybe a sandwich, and he will be over later tonight As she was changing into something more comfortable, she thought of his words, as he was hanging up the phone "MAYBE we can go out to dinner next month, if I can work it into my schedule.......oh yeah, I love you, Babe." ???!!!???
